Student Emergency Aid Fund
The Student Emergency Aid Fund exists to help students who need help with one-time school or life expenses up to $1,000. This financial assistance can be used for:
- tuition
- rent
- vehicle loan payments and repairs
- textbooks
- or almost any other expense.
All enrolled students are eligible to apply for emergency aid. Supporting documentation must be provided with your application.
